AstraZeneca PLC

HEALTHCARE · DRUG MANUFACTURERS - GENERAL · USA

AstraZeneca PLC discovers, develops, manufactures and markets prescription drugs in the areas of oncology, cardiovascular, renal and metabolism, respiratory, infections, neuroscience and gastroenterology worldwide. The company is headquartered in Cambridge, the United Kingdom.

Retractable Technologies Inc

HEALTHCARE · MEDICAL INSTRUMENTS & SUPPLIES · USA

Retractable Technologies, Inc. designs, develops, manufactures, and markets safety syringes and other medical products for the healthcare industry in the United States, the rest of North and South America, and internationally. The company is headquartered in Little Elm, Texas.
